Is Bali or Mauritius more beautiful?

Bali's beaches are known for their dramatic scenery, with rugged cliffs, towering palm trees, and iconic rock formations like the Tanah Lot temple. In contrast, Mauritius has a more serene and tranquil feel, with gentle waves and lush greenery surrounding its beaches.

Which month is best for Bali?

The best time to visit Bali is between April and October, the island's dry season. Although the weather is ideal for travellers, the island is also subject to soupy, humid days throughout the year. Many shops offer sales and promotions; restaurants are less crowded in those mid-season months.

What month is the cheapest to visit Bali?

The cheapest time to visit Bali apart from the wet season is just before and just after the high season, that is, in the months of March and November. During these periods, humidity is not too much, and water sports and other adventure activities can be enjoyed.

What is the hottest time of year to go to Bali?

Hottest time in Bali

The hottest months in Bali are April and October, when daytime temperatures can rise up to 32°C. Humidity levels in the coastal areas can reach up to 75%. The island receives an ample 12 hours of sunlight with average daytime temperatures ranging from 27 to 32°C during these times.
